#f9c067 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9c067 is composed of 97.6% red, 75.3%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 58.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 36.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 69%. #f9c067 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#f38100.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f9c067 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f9c067 has RGB values of R:249, G:192,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.59,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16367719.

Hex triplet f9c067 #f9c067
RGB Decimal 249, 192, 103 rgb(249,192,103)
RGB Percent 97.6, 75.3, 40.4 rgb(97.6%,75.3%,40.4%)
CMYK 0, 23, 59, 2
HSL 36.6°, 92.4, 69 hsl(36.6,92.4%,69%)
HSV (or HSB) 36.6°, 58.6, 97.6
Web Safe ffcc66 #ffcc66
CIE-LAB 81.193, 10.851, 52.011
XYZ 60.365, 58.821, 21.005
xyY 0.431, 0.42, 58.821
CIE-LCH 81.193, 53.131, 78.216
CIE-LUV 81.193, 44.599, 61.277
Hunter-Lab 76.695, 6.278, 37.448
Binary 11111001, 11000000, 01100111

Shades and Tints of #f9c067

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120b01 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f9c067 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#c7c7c7 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d1c6b4 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e0cc71 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f8c36e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ffbac6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e9c76d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#f8c26c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fcbca3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
